Bouka beach is found on the north east coast of
Zakynthos (Zante) island and a mere eight kilometres from the islands capital
Zakynthos Town.
Fishermen looking for a little early morning peace and quiet need search no further than the small harbour of Bouka Beach and sitting at the shore watching them come and go is a great relaxing activity for everyone else.
With plenty of sand, shallow waters, and no organised water sports to interrupt your sunbathing, this tranquil, unspoiled cove is perfect for swimmers, families with children, and anybody else after a purely restful holiday. Just watch out for the rocks around the waters edge.
Traditional tavernas and beach bars are sprinkled nearby, so you don’t have to go far for a snack break. Bouka is an ideal place to unwind, take a quick dip in the sea, and work on your tan.
There are sun loungers available to hire but they are not too packed in like you’d find on the islands most popular beaches, there’s also plenty of room to lay out a towel if you prefer. Bouka is a great place to try a bit of snorkelling as the water is beautifully clear.
